Output 620af761e0fcbcd96d41c918aa99f72f9af24f1d162dcfddda164633639765e7:1

value
1988920374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2016ca49448ecd5f33ae1c6b29c3dc106a5140f9 OP_EQUAL
address
34cgrAvHDrDTLYjCKTT1qFXPwwTJJqxGdL
transaction
620af761e0fcbcd96d41c918aa99f72f9af24f1d162dcfddda164633639765e7
confirmations
552895
spent
true